The high-performance 7 Series model is a collaboration between the Bavarian automaker and German performance tuner Alpina. The Alpina B7 gets a modified version of BMW's 4.4-liter V8 mated to a six-speed automatic transmission with steering-wheel-mounted controls. Engine output is 500 hp at 5,500 rpm with a maximum torque of 516 pound-feet at 4,250 rpm. The Alpina B7 sprints from zero to 60 mph in 4.8 seconds.Alpina custom touches include 21-inch wheels with Z-rated performance tires, a sport-tuned suspension with active roll stabilization and a B7 aero kit with a rear spoiler.
